*BEWARE* eBay Scam Alert
I just talked to Murff about this and thought it'd be a good idea to alert forum members. There are two listings currently on eBay for OCD lanterns (see links below). Both of these lanterns were sold in eBay auctions within the last month or so and this seller has copied the photos and text from the original listings. As you'll see, buried within the photos, is a buy-it-now offer that requires the buyer to email the seller directly and do the sale outside of eBay. I don't believe this seller actually owns the lanterns and this is a scam.

Re: *BEWARE* eBay Scam Alert
They say in the listing that they won't respond to eBay messages, so I think they've got that wired. They want an email to their private address so they can harvest information. Like I said...no way they actually have these lanterns. It's pretty surprising that eBay is leaving these listings up this long.
